Responsibilities

  • Recruitment & Onboarding: Assist in the full-cycle recruitment process, including posting job openings, screening resumes, and scheduling interviews for the Glendale area.
  • Employee Relations: Serve as the primary point of contact for employee inquiries, resolving conflicts, and maintaining a positive work environment.
  • Administrative Support: Manage employee files, maintain accurate records in HRIS systems, and prepare HR documentation.
  • Training Coordination: Coordinate training sessions and onboarding activities for new hires to ensure a smooth transition.
  • Compliance: Ensure all HR practices adhere to local and federal regulations and company policies.
  • Benefits Administration: Assist employees with enrollment and questions regarding benefits packages.

Qualifications

  • Education: High school diploma or GED required;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or related field is a plus.
  • Experience: No prior HR experience required; paid training provided for the right candidate.
  • Skills: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Communication: Excellent verbal and written communication skills with a professional demeanor.
  • Computer Literacy: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and HR software (e.g., BambooHR, Workday).
  • Attitude: A proactive, teachable, and team-oriented mindset.
